Front Desk Agent
Starting Rate is $20.00 per hour
We are looking for a Front Desk Agent to serve as our guests’ first point of contact (first impression) and manage all aspects of their accommodation in our AAA Four Diamond luxury resort – the finest in Lake Placid. We are looking for some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ment while providing exemplary service to our guests. Join our team and work among the best in the hotel/resort business. This is a full time, year-round position. If you have a knack for customer service and work experience in the hotel industry, we’d like to meet you. Ultimately, you will help create a pleasant and memorable stay for our guests.
Responsibilities
- Perform all check-in and check-out tasks
- Inform customers about payment methods and verify their credit card data
- Register guests collecting necessary information (like contact details and exact dates of their stay)
- Welcome guests upon their arrival and assign rooms
- Provide information about our hotel, available rooms, rates and amenities
- Respond to clients’ complaints in a timely and professional manner
- Liaise with our housekeeping staff to ensure all rooms are clean, tidy and fully furnished to accommodate guests’ needs
- Upsell additional facilities and services, when appropriate like dining, spa, salon, amenities, etc.

Part Time Night Audit
Starting Rate is $23.00 per hour
We’re looking for a Part-Time Night Auditor to assist guests with their overnight requests and balance accounts from the day shift. Night Auditor responsibilities include checking in guests, checking out guests, handling their requests and taking reservations. The Night Auditor also reconciles all accounts. Ultimately, you will provide excellent customer service to guests and keep the front desk and accounting operations running smoothly.
Responsibilities
- Check in guests, check out guests, answer phones
- Respond to guest complaints, requests and emergencies
- Reconcile accounts
- Balance the cash drawer and log receipts
- Investigate and resolve out-of-balance accounts
- Keep accurate financial records and ledgers
- Help prepare for forecasts and audits
